How matching plastics to glue improves results

Matching styrene, ABS, and soft polystyrene to the right formula prevents melting, fogging, or weak joints. Flow and cure speed affect clamp time and final clarity, so read labels before joining critical areas.

Simple guidance for confident assembly

Apply thin, even beads, join parts in sequence, and keep pieces stable until set. Ventilate the workspace, avoid skin contact, and wipe excess cement quickly for cleaner results.

FAQ

Which glue works best for Warhammer plastic models?

Most players prefer a medium viscosity Cyanoacrylate gel for general plastic assembly and a solvent cement for styrene seams.

Is super glue stronger than traditional plastic cement?

Super glue dries faster and suits small fixes, while plastic cement creates deeper bonds by melting edges together for load-bearing joints.
